My friend Krazymond is nearly finished with the Fiero based my 86GT "Rachel" for Grand Theft Auto 4. For those of you familiar with the version he made me for the game "Mafia" this one will be even better. Ive been working with him over the last month to get the model more accurate. The best thing about making the Fiero for GTA is that he can set the car to random so most of the time you should be seeing the fiero driving down the street totally stock with original wheels color and interior but occasionally youll see them driving around wingless, custom wheels and interiors and suped up engines.

Here is a video of the incomplete version.(Note how many fieros he drives by while in first person mode) He is going to rework the nose a bit. Its still too blocky.
